Wizard with a Gun demo available now

Huzzah!

A Wizard with a Gun single player demo is now available for players to check out, all part of Devolver’s offerings at Summer Game Fest.

“The demo starts from the beginning of your wizard’s arrival upon The Shatter – a broken world slowly being invaded by chaos,” Devolver and developer Galvanic Games said in a press release.

“It’s up to you to adventure through this world to collect resources, build out your tower and the helpful machinations within, and push back the encroaching chaos. There is a helpful tutorial along the way, though a lot is still left to mystery and for you to discover.”

The demo is expected to take most players between two to three hours to complete; it’ll end after the first boss battle.

“However, eager wizards can keep exploring The Imperium as long as desired to find and experiment with higher level loot dropped by downed Gunslingers,” the press release continued.

Wizard with a Gun is planned for a 2023 release on Windows PC via Steam, Xbox Series S, Xbox Series X and PS5.
